The purpose of this study was to investigate the relationship between exercise habits and sleep quality in De Lin Institute of Technology. The participants college students including 666 male (with mean age of male 17.58±1.44 years; high 172.57±6.12 cm; weigh 67.20±12.61 kg), and 398 female (with mean age of male 17.85±1.46 years; high 160.53±6.60 cm; weigh 56.32±10.68 kg). Pittsburgh Sleep Quality Index (PSQI) was used and data were analyzed by SPSS for window 18.0, descriptive statistics, Chi-square test, two independent sample t-tests, and Pearson Relationship Index. The significance difference α=.05. The results showed: (1). In exercise habits, the exercise frequency per one week is 1.96±1.75 in male and 1.15±1.41 in female, respectively. An exercise time is 30 to 60 minutes. Ball games are more frequency than other sports. (2). In sleep quality, female sleep score is 6.16±3.13 and male sleep score is 5.39±2.90. (3). In sleep duration, sleep efficiency, sleep time, sleep disturbances and subjective sleep quality, daytime function and sleep scores have significant differences (P <.05). (4). BMI index, exercise times, and sleep duration have significance negative relationship, but sleep score and go to bed time has a significance positive relationship. Conclusions: Exercise habits have greatly improvement range in De Lin Institute of Technology. All students have a poor sleep quality. We suggested that regular exercise habits to improve personal health and sleep quality.
